“Good luck with your meeting today, Kyle,” Charlotte said as I waited for the corporate lawyer to call.
Whichever deal came out on top, he would handle the next step—reaching out to the Chief Legal Officer of that company to hammer out fair terms on my behalf. I’d read through all three offers, but the legal jargon was impossible to decipher. Half of it might as well have been in Sanskrit.
“Thanks, sweetie,” I said, then flicked off her voice response system.
A moment later, her text flowed onto the screen.
[I’m so excited for you. I love your plan to break me out of your computer.]
I smiled and tapped my reply.
Not as excited as I am. You’ll be in the latest Cyber Doll model. You’ll be perfect.
The video call rang twice before a sharp-looking man in a grey suit appeared on screen. He didn’t smile. Just nodded.
“Mr. Foster?” I asked, adjusting my mic.
“Correct. Kyle Jackson. I’ve reviewed all three licensing offers. You made the right call asking for independent legal counsel before signing anything.”
I nodded, my heart racing.“So…?”
He glanced down at his tablet.“Nano-Tech Industries is your best option. Their deal offers the cleanest terms, strongest protection for your intellectual property, and, frankly, the deepest pockets.”
“What’s the structure?”
“Two-part. You’ll receive a bulk credit payment of 450,000 cr upfront as an exclusive licensing fee. That’s tax-free in your jurisdiction and pays out within 48 hours of signature.”
I blinked.“Four hundred and fifty…?”
He kept going.“Then, you’ll receive a 6% share of all net revenue generated from ReSkin™ sales. That includes every product that uses your patented bio-adaptive polymer—globally.”
“And the other companies?”
“One capped your royalties at 2% after year one. The other wanted to buy you out entirely—for a fraction of this.”
“Yeah. Fuck that.”
He allowed the faintest smile.“Wise.”
I leaned closer to the screen.“And Nano… they’re serious about pushing this globally?”
“Very. They’re committing a minimum marketing spend of 20 million credits over the first quarter alone. That includes targeted immersive ads, interactive product demos, and integration into smart-home networks. It’s aggressive. They’re betting on you.”
My stomach flipped.“Holy shit.”
“Nano-Tech has a proven track record launching companion tech. They’re positioning ReSkin™ as the missing link between tactile response and emotional realism. They want to redefine synthetic interaction.”
“And they think my tech’s the key to that?”
“They don’t think, Kyle. They know. You’ve made something that blurs the line.”
I exhaled slowly, barely able to sit still.“And you’re sure I’m protected?”
“You retain full ownership of the patent. They license it under strict parameters. You’re not selling them your soul—just leasing your brainchild for massive gain.”
I nodded again.“Draw up the paperwork. I want this done today.”
“It’s already in your inbox. Read carefully, then sign with digital trace. I’ll handle the rest.”
